Information About

This book contains material developed for use in an interdisciplinary graduate course on product development that have been taught at MIT. It blends the perspectives of marketing, design, and manufacturing into a single approach to product development. Also relevant for industrial practitioners, it provides a set of product development methodologies that can be put into immediate practice on development projects.
